How they compare

New Zealand currently reports 0.2596 current US$ per US$ of GDP against 0.2554 current US$ per US$ of GDP in Bolivia, a difference of 0.0042 current US$ per US$ of GDP.

The two have swapped places 14 times across 55 shared years of data; in 1970 it was New Zealand ahead.

Bolivia ranks 159th and New Zealand ranks 157th of 193 countries.

Across the 6 decades both report, Bolivia averaged higher in 4 and New Zealand in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Bolivia New Zealand Difference Ahead
1970s 0.2771 current US$ per US$ of GDP 0.2681 current US$ per US$ of GDP 0.0091 current US$ per US$ of GDP Bolivia
1980s 0.2433 current US$ per US$ of GDP 0.2848 current US$ per US$ of GDP 0.0415 current US$ per US$ of GDP New Zealand
1990s 0.2792 current US$ per US$ of GDP 0.2743 current US$ per US$ of GDP 0.0049 current US$ per US$ of GDP Bolivia
2000s 0.303 current US$ per US$ of GDP 0.2992 current US$ per US$ of GDP 0.0038 current US$ per US$ of GDP Bolivia
2010s 0.337 current US$ per US$ of GDP 0.2738 current US$ per US$ of GDP 0.0632 current US$ per US$ of GDP Bolivia
2020s 0.2545 current US$ per US$ of GDP 0.2592 current US$ per US$ of GDP 0.0047 current US$ per US$ of GDP New Zealand

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
